What are supermarkets?

Supermarkets are large retail stores that sell food and other merchandise. Since the introduction of supermarkets into the retail sector, the retail market has been redefined and consumers have experienced great convenience, price and choice. The supermarket has been a defining factor of the retail market and is responsible for the market changes that have occurred.
